프랑스 그르노블 연구팀의 아멜리에 헬리오 연구원은 게임 이론에 관심이 많습니다. 평생 학습을 지향하며 생물 정보학에서 그래프 이론까지, 다채로운 분야에서 연구 경력을 보유한 아멜리에는 전 세계를 여행하기도 했습니다. 거기에서 그치지 않습니다. 그르노블에 위치한 Criteo AI Lab 연구팀에 입사한 후, 아멜리에는 크리테오가 광고 성과의 향상(incrementality)에 대해 보다 심층적인 연구를 할 수 있도록 지원하고 있습니다.
이번 주에는 아멜리에와 함께, 그녀의 전공 분야인 성과 향상(incrementality)에 대해 이야기를 나눠보고, 어떻게 Criteo AI Lab에 입사하게 되었는지 알아보겠습니다.
처음부터 시작을 해보겠습니다. 어디 출신이십니까?
저는 프랑스 파리에서 나고 자랐습니다. 파리 공과대학교에서 생물 정보학을 전공했구요. 파리-사클레 대학에서 생물 정보학 박사 학위를 받았습니다. 박사 학위 덕분에 여러 곳을 여행하고 다른 연구원들을 만날 수 있는 기회를 가졌습니다. LIG(Grenoble Computer Sciences Laboratory)에서 포닥(박사후 연구원)으로 게임 이론에 대해 연구를 했습니다.
이 분야에 어떻게 관심을 가지게 되었나요?
공과 대학교 마지막 학년 때 생물 정보학 연구 석사 과정을 이수했기 때문에 박사 과정을 밟고 연구 분야에서 일하는 것이 당연한 수순이었어요. 더 배우고 싶다는 생각 때문에 전문 석사가 아니라 연구 석사를 선택했죠. 그 후에 뭘 하고 싶은지는 사실 잘 몰랐어요.
고등학교 때부터 생물에 관심이 많았고 분자와 의약품에 관련된 일을 하고 싶었기 때문에 생물 정보학을 선택했죠. 나중에서야 컴퓨터 과학에 대한 흥미가 생겼어요. 대학교에 다닐 때였는데 너무나 흥미로워서 연구를 한번 해보고 싶은 생각이 드는 거에요. 그래프 이론과 게임 이론을 통한 분자의 3D 형상에 관한 연구로 박사 학위를 받았습니다.
생물 정보학이 대단히 흥미로운 분야라는 생각에는 변함이 없지만, 박사 학위를 받은 후에 좀 더 이론적인 분야로 이동을 했어요. 박사 후 연구는 네트워크에 적용된 게임 이론에 관한 것이었습니다. 박사 후 연구가 재미있긴 했지만, 제 연구로 더 큰 목표를 달성하는데 도움을 주고 싶었어요. 이론적인 증거를 공부하기 보다는 더 큰 프로젝트의 일부가 되고 싶었죠.
그래서 흥미로운 일을 하는 기업들을 눈여겨 보기 시작했어요. 기업의 목표가 제 연구의 방향을 잡아줄 수 있도록 말이죠. 그런 면에서 크리테오가 완벽했어요. 제 전공인 수학과 게임 이론이 머신 러닝이라는 주제와 일부 상통하는 면이 있었고, 머신 러닝과 딥 러닝에 대해 더 많은 통찰을 얻을 수 있도록 머신 러닝 전문가들과 함께 일할 수가 있었거든요. 그리고 연구 작업이 모집단을 대상으로 A/B 테스트를 수행할 수 있어야 하는 것도 제겐 중요했어요. 크리테오에서는 모집단뿐만 아니라 성과를 개선하는데도 연구 작업을 활용합니다.
연구원들이 정확하게 어떤 일을 하는지 모르는 독자들도 있을텐데요, 배경 설명을 좀 해주시겠어요?
연구 작업은 연구자와 연구 주제에 따라 많은 차이가 있어요. 연구 작업은 크게 3가지로 구성된다고 할 수 있죠.
먼저, 논문을 읽고 강의를 들으며 매일 지식을 쌓습니다. 크리테오는 연구원들이 온라인 공개수업(MOOC)을 수강하고 워크샵과 컨퍼런스에 참가하는 것을 권장해요. 모든 게 연구 분야의 새로운 추세를 읽는 데 필요한 일이죠. 두 번째는 우리가 답을 제공할 수 있는 질문이나 필요를 도출합니다. 마지막으로 실험을 설계하거나 알고리즘과 증명에 대한 연구를 통해 그 질문이나 필요에 대한 답을 제공하려는 시도를 합니다.
크리테오에서는 어떤 질문에 어떻게 대답을 하려고 했는지 모두 기록하고 다른 연구원들과 토론하도록 되어 있어요. 팀으로서 노력을 하자는 것인데, 혼자 어려운 문제를 연구하면서 방향을 잃지 않는데 도움이 되고 자극이 됩니다.
연구 때문에 정말 여러 곳을 여행하셨네요. 러시아, 홍콩, 팔로 알토 등등, 그르노블의 Criteo AI Lab에 안착하신 이유는 뭔가요?
박사 과정을 밟으면서 정말 여러 곳을 여행할 기회가 있었어요. 정말 좋았죠. 몇 달 동안 여행을 하고 다른 나라의 연구원들을 만나 함께 작업을 한다는 것은 나 스스로에게 대단히 도움이 되는 일이에요. 그런데 저는 항상 유럽에 정착하고 싶었어요. 파리 근처에 살았었는데, 박사 후 연구를 위해 그르노블에 오자마자 도시가 정말 맘에 들었죠.
파리는 아름다운 도시이긴 하지만 출퇴근하는데 너무 오래 걸리고 월세도 비싸요. 개인적으로 그르노블에서는 삶의 질이 더 높은 것 같아요. 자전거나 트램을 타고 출근을 하고(교통도 덜 혼잡하고 지하철 지연도 없고), 자동차가 없어도 다양한 야외 활동을 할 수 있죠. 그래서 직장을 알아보면서 그르노블에 위치한 곳을 우선적으로 알아봤어요.
머신 러닝에 대한 지식을 넓히면서 연구를 하고 싶었기 때문에 Criteo AI Lab에 입사하기로 했죠. Criteo AI Lab에는 많은 머신 러닝 전문 연구원들이 있어서 제게는 완벽한 장소였습니다. 그르노블에는 20명이 좀 넘는 연구원들이 있는데 대부분이 엔지니어들이고 연구팀이 아담해요. 팀의 규모가 작다는 게 단점이 아니에요. 필요하면 모두 다 함께 파리로 출장을 갈 수도 있거든요. 보통은 비디오 콜을 통해 Criteo AI Lab의 연구원들과 소통을 해요.
저는 낮에는 조용하고 차분한 분위기의 사무실에서 일을 하고 어쩌다 한번씩 파리에 가는 이런 생활이 좋아요.
크리테오에 입사한 후에는 어떤 연구를 해왔나요?
저는 그르노블 연구팀의 다른 연구원들과 증분에 대한 연구를 하고 있어요. 제게는 생소한 분야였는데,점점 흥미가 생겼어요.
먼저, 웹사이트를 클릭 또는 방문한다거나 뭔가 구매를 하는 등 사용자가 행동할 확률에 광고가 어떤 영향을 미치는지를 연구합니다. 저희의 연구는 가치가 아니라 확률을 높이는데 중점을 둬요. 예를 들어, 사용자의 행동 확률을 0.8에서 0.85로 높여주는 광고가 아니라 0.4에서 0.6으로 높여주는 광고에 높게 입찰을 합니다. 값이 더 높은 0.85가 아니라 0.2라는 더 큰 증분값을 우선시하는 거죠.
일반적으로, 광고주는 사용자의 행동을 유발할 확률이 더 높은 광고를 표시해요. 그러나 크리테오는 증분을 통해, 확률의 큰 폭 향상에 더 중점을 둘 수 있다는 사실을 보여주고 싶은 거죠. 이는 사용자에게 어차피 구매할 상품의 광고를 표시하는 것이 아니라 사용자의 관심을 끄는 광고를 더 표시하는 것으로 연결되요.
크리테오의 연구에서 사람들이 예상치 못하는 점이 있다면 뭐가 있을까요?
처음 입사하고 가장 놀랐던 것은 크리테오가 교육에 얼마나 중점을 두는가 하는 거였어요.
입사한 후 첫 달에는 Criteo Engine, 제품, 그리고 팀들에 익숙해질 수 있도록 신입사원들이 여러 작은 그룹으로 나뉘어져서 정말 엄청난 양의 온라인 및 오프라인 교육을 받았어요. 대단하다고 생각했죠. 곧바로 크리테오라는 큰 가족의 일원이 된 느낌이 들었거든요. 제가 전문이 아닌 분야에 대한 교육은 특히 도움이 되었어요.
일을 하지 않을 때는 어떤 취미 생활을 하나요?
그르노블에는 취미 생활로 할 것이 참 많아요. 조깅, 자전거 타기, 암벽등반, 스키 등 대부분이 야외 활동이죠. 저는 조깅을 좋아해요. 트랙이나 거리에서 주로 달리는데 그르노블에 있는 모든 산책길들이 정말 좋아요. 자전거 타기 좋은 곳들도 많이 있어요. 최근에는 그르노블에서 연극을 시작했어요. 그르노블은 파리만큼 문화 활동이 풍성하지는 않아도 있을 만큼 있고, 어디나 다 가깝기 때문에 쉽게 참여를 할 수 있어요.
마지막으로 이 분야에서 연구원이 되고자 하는 이들에게 조언을 해준다면?
머신 러닝 분야의 연구원이라면 과감하게 크리테오에 지원해보라고 말하고 싶어요. 크리테오가 여러분 같은 사람을 찾고 있거든요. 머신 러닝 분야의 연구원이 아니라면, 이 분야, 특히 신경망 분야에 익숙해져야 해요. 도움이 될 만한 책과 강의가 많이 나와 있어요.
감사합니다, 아멜리에!
Criteo AI Lab에 관심이 있으십니까? 보다 자세한 정보를 원하시면 여기를 클릭하시고, 크리테오의 기업 문화에 대한 모든 것은 여기를 클릭하십시오!